Umino Iruka was a misfit orphan who spent his time in high school drawing on his assignments during class and causing trouble. When his art teacher noticed that he actually had some talent, she entered an application for him in Konoha's scholarship program, which he (unexpectedly) won. He left Konoha for the city of Sunagakure at 18 with nothing but his art supplies and a duffel bag...

After earning a degree in fine arts he decided that teaching was where his heart lay and took out enough loans to get a 2-year degree in education.

Iruka finally graduated and tried, unsuccessfully, to find a job teaching at a school in Suna for months. When the bills started piling up, he had no choice but to return home and take up his old high school job again to make ends meet. He worked nights as a waiter, back in the small but well-frequented restaurant called Ichiraku's. During the day he searched for a job where he could put his love for art, teaching, and impressionable young minds to good use.

He had been back home for two months when he saw a promising ad in the classifieds of the Konoha Times. It read: "Wanted: Art Teacher for NINJA High. Great pay, benefits, and all the students you can handle." He didn't know about the last part... but the great pay and benefits sounded good! Iruka called the number, interviewed, was hired and the rest is history....

Iruka is a good soul with a kind disposition, but he does have a temper and can fall back into his misfit ways with enough 'persuasion' (usually in the form of sake)... People wonder sometimes if there isn't something a little more devious hidden behind that cheerful and caring exterior. Is he really as innocent as he seems or is it all an act? We'll see!
